We are looking for a Chef de Partie to to work across all sections of the College's busy kitchen, supporting the Head Chef and Senior Sous Chef in the efficient day-to-day operation of the Catering Department. The role involves preparing and delivering high-quality meals for pupils, staff and visitors, as well as contributing to the successful delivery of high-volume hospitality, conferences, functions and College events, maintaining the highest standards of food quality, hygiene and customer service throughout.

As Chef de Partie, you will be a hands-on member of the team with energy, drive and a genuine passion for producing exceptional food. You will thrive in a fast-paced, high-volume kitchen environment and be able to work calmly and effectively under pressure. Experience gained within education, contract catering, restaurants or hotels would be advantageous. Above all, you will be a flexible team player with a positive, proactive 'can-do' attitude and a commitment to delivering an outstanding catering service.

37.5 hours per week, worked on a rota basis to include some bank holidays. Hours will predominately be Monday to Friday 07:00-15:00, however the post holder will be expected to adopt a flexible approach to hours of work. Additional hours will be required at peak times with paid overtime.
